Specs
| Released | 2025-12-01 | 2024-08-20 |
| Context window | 128K | 128K |
| Parameters | — | 16x3.8B (42B, 6.6B active) |
| Architecture | decoder only | decoder only |
| License | Proprietary | MIT |
| Knowledge cutoff | - | - |
